    Grizzlies Shopping Harrington According to the Vancouver Sun, with the Grizzlies poised to take a power forward - either Stromile Swift, Kenyon Martin and Marcus Fizer - it's no surprise they're shopping incumbent Othella Harrington. That's sure to make Harrington happy. He doesn't like Vancouver and wasn't thrilled when Knight suggested he might be better suited to coming off the bench. Sources say the Grizzlies are soliciting offers for the 6'8' 235-pounder, hoping to land another first-round pick. With five years left on his contract at a relatively low salary - $2.8 million next year - Harrington could be attractive on the trade market. - Grizzly Rants
